Well Friday May 9th was a holiday here in Kazakhstan it is their Victory Day the day they separated form the Soviet Union. On Thursday night we got a call that our driver was going to be late taking us to the orphanage because of family obligation. Which worked out great because early Friday morning we started to here music out side our apartment and went to see what was going on. The police had our road blocked off and looking way up our road we could see people walking. Then the music got closer, once they were right in front of our apartment we could see it was their vets walking to Panfilov Park for celebration. We decide to get ready for the day and walk to the park. It was really nice at the park, they have monuments for there fallen soldiers and people would place flowers on top of he monuments. While we were walking at one point we were behind 3 vets and people would just stop them so they could say thanks and give them flowers. They really give them a lot respect for serving. In the park they have what is an eternal flame and people had laid flowers all around it, it looked amazing. They had put up a stage and they had music and dancers performing all the time. Balloons, windmills, necklaces, peacock feathers and a lot more fun things for kids. Horse back rides and carriage rides through the park. Then last night when we got back from the orphanage we had fireworks that we watched over the building across the street from us. We couldn’t see the low ones but we still got to see quit a bit of them. We are happy we went late to the orphanage now we can tell Baby Larrick about how they celebrate Victory Day in Kaz.
